MagnaCarta 2 is the third in the MagnaCarta series, and the second to be translated into english. As with most jRPGs, knowledge of the other installments isn't necessary. The story centres around Juto, a man who has amnesia and a war between two sides (the rather lazily named Northern and Southern forces). The war comes to the island he lives on and he gets involved afterwards. Obviously there's more to it than that, but it still isn't that interesting. It's abit of a confusing mess, but there are worse stories in jRPGs. There is some characterisation of the cast but in general it's very limited and doesn't add much to the story or the characters.

TomorrowNever Dies (1997) is the 18th Bond film, and the second starring Pierce Brosnan as James Bond. Brosnan's first outing as Bond in Goldeneye in 1995 was a great success following a 6 year gap since Timothy Dalton's Bond in Licence to Kill in1989. Goldeneye bridged the gap following the end of the Cold War and the reduction of Soviet villains for Bond, and paved the way for a more modern Bond dealing with more topical issues, as we see here in TomorrowNever Dies.
The Plot
Despite the efforts of James Bond to prevent him, American terrorist Henry Gupta acquires a GPS encoder used by British forces to sell to media giant Elliot Carver, who plans to use the encoder to start a war between China and the Unted Kingdom.
